Calculate Log Base 199 of 183

To solve the equation log 199 (183)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 183, a = 199:
    log 199 (183) = log(183) / log(199)
  3. Evaluate the term:
    log(183) / log(199)
    = 1.39794000867204 / 1.92427928606188
    = 0.9841651530266
    = Logarithm of 183 with base 199
